If you’ve recently walked inside a Church, you may recall seeing fourteen paintings or sculptures representing Jesus’ journey from the time He is sentenced to death until His body is laid in the tomb. These Stations of the Cross (also known as the Way of the Cross) draw us closer to Jesus as we reflect on the immeasurable love He poured out for us in his suffering and dying.

Tradition traces this ancient form of prayer back to Our Blessed Mother, when she made her own journey retracing her Son’s last steps. Mary’s reflection on the events and encounters of Jesus on His way to Calvary, is known as the Via Dolorosa, or the Sorrowful Way.

While this prayer has its roots that date back centuries, there is a depth and power to it, that when prayed today, can help transform our modern world. We come to understand that “we are not bystanders to an historical event,” but called to find ourselves in the story.
